Best Numeric Keypads for Mac 2022

Numeric keypads are essential for financial professionals and simplify data entry for everyone who uses Numbers or Excel, or anyone who is used to using a ten-key keypad. There are no Macs being shipped today that come standard with a numeric keypad on the keyboard. This means that you may look to purchase one separately. We have searched high and low for the best numeric keypads for Mac, so let's explore what features to look for and what makes each one different.
Extension of Magic Keyboard
The Belkin YourType Bluetooth Wireless Keypad is an extension of the existing Mac's Magic Keyboard. It features 28 keys, including function and navigation controls. It works wirelessly via Bluetooth and is powered by two AA batteries.
Rechargable and functional
The Macally Wireless Number Pad features a 300mAh rechargeable battery that can go for a month between charges. It has a 35 key layout with scissor-switch keycaps to make for easy typing. The Macally also includes six shortcut keys, arrow keys, and LED indicators.
Wired and inexpensive
This keypad is wired, so you need to have an extra USB-A port available. So, for most modern Macs, that means you will need a dongle or USB-C hub as well. It's plug-and-play, with 22 scissor-switch keys and an ergonomic design.
Match your Mac
This rechargeable Bluetooth wireless keypad features a slim aluminum design to match up with your Mac. It has 34 keys, including function and arrow keys. This Lekvey lasts up to two weeks on a single charge of 1-2 hours.
Numeric keypad and USB hub
This unique number pad also features a USB hub. It works wirelessly via Bluetooth and charges via USB-C cable. If you want to use one of the USB 3.0 ports to transfer data, the keypad must be connected to your computer first. The Cofuture features 34 keys, although some special keys are non-functional for Macs.

Numeric keypads are important for entering numeric data into your spreadsheets and other documents. You can buy a wide variety of keypads, either wired or wireless, rechargeable or battery-operated, basic keys or additional function keys, and the option for backlighting. For very little money, you can upgrade your Mac typing experience by adding a numeric keypad.
The Belkin YourType is our favorite, if only because of its similarities to a standard Apple Magic Keyboard. It will match your setup perfectly and add numeric and function keys to help with your numeric data entry. While it lacks a rechargeable battery and backlight, it works wirelessly and looks great next to your Magic Keyboard.
If you have an available USB port, then the Macally Wired USB Numeric Keypad may be all you need. It will perform the basic function of giving you a numeric keypad for the least amount of money possible.
